The first five Hermite polynomials are 1, 2t, −2 + 4t 2 , −12t + 8t 3 , and 12 − 48t 2 + 16t 4 . These polynomials arise naturally in the study of certain important differential equations in mathematical physics. Show that the first five Hermite polynomials form a basis of P4.
